Vector-Select: Address one of the problems in pr10902. Add handling for the
integer-promotion of CONCAT_VECTORS. Test: test/CodeGen/X86/widen_shuffle-1.ll This patch fixes the above tests (when running in with -promote-elements). git-svn-id: https://llvm.org/svn/llvm-project/llvm/trunk@140372 91177308-0d34-0410-b5e6-96231b3b80d8

+SDValue DAGTypeLegalizer::PromoteIntRes_CONCAT_VECTORS(SDNode *N) {
+ DebugLoc dl = N->getDebugLoc();
+
+ SDValue Op0 = N->getOperand(1);
+ SDValue Op1 = N->getOperand(1);
+ assert(Op0.getValueType() == Op1.getValueType() &&
+ "Invalid input vector types");
+
+ EVT OutVT = N->getValueType(0);
+ EVT NOutVT = TLI.getTypeToTransformTo(*DAG.getContext(), OutVT);
+ assert(NOutVT.isVector() && "This type must be promoted to a vector type");
+
+ EVT OutElemTy = NOutVT.getVectorElementType();
+
+ unsigned NumElem0 = Op0.getValueType().getVectorNumElements();
+ unsigned NumElem1 = Op1.getValueType().getVectorNumElements();
+ unsigned NumOutElem = NOutVT.getVectorNumElements();
+ assert(NumElem0 + NumElem1 == NumOutElem &&
+ "Invalid number of incoming elements");
+
+ // Take the elements from the first vector.
+ SmallVector<SDValue, 8> Ops(NumOutElem);
+ for (unsigned i = 0; i < NumElem0; ++i) {
+ SDValue Ext = DAG.getNode(ISD::EXTRACT_VECTOR_ELT, dl,
+ Op0.getValueType().getScalarType(), Op0,
+ DAG.getIntPtrConstant(i));
+ Ops[i] = DAG.getNode(ISD::ANY_EXTEND, dl, OutElemTy, Ext);
+ }
+
+ // Take the elements from the second vector
+ for (unsigned i = 0; i < NumElem1; ++i) {
+ SDValue Ext = DAG.getNode(ISD::EXTRACT_VECTOR_ELT, dl,
+ Op1.getValueType().getScalarType(), Op1,
+ DAG.getIntPtrConstant(i));
+ Ops[i + NumElem0] = DAG.getNode(ISD::ANY_EXTEND, dl, OutElemTy, Ext);
+ }
+
+ return DAG.getNode(ISD::BUILD_VECTOR, dl, NOutVT, &Ops[0], Ops.size());
+}
